Output 12c509989a29a9acf7dff18b62c45b546433a29a21591b7e7f4394cf21358ae7:12

value
423680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a94eb7f3c00e7307492eea52b8e09483ba5055 OP_EQUAL
address
3GFEBjdFnBdEgUhdjbkfZQu7JKdfL8G9bM
transaction
12c509989a29a9acf7dff18b62c45b546433a29a21591b7e7f4394cf21358ae7
spent
true